A leading independent consultancy in Gatwick is seeking an Associate Transport Planner to lead projects from inception to completion. The role involves supporting directors, meeting clients, and collaborating with external consultants.
Ideal candidates should have:
- 4-5 years of experience in transport planning
- Knowledge of relevant software
- A full clean driving licence
This position offers a dynamic opportunity in the growing transportation sector.
